COVID-19 cases on Sunday, bringing the total number of cases in the province to 545,803.“Locally, there are 49 new cases in the Region of Waterloo, 42 in Toronto, 25 in Grey Bruce, 17 in Peel Region and 12 in Halton Region,” Health Minister Christine Elliott said.For comparison, last Sunday 287 cases were reported.Nine new deaths were also announced on July 4, bringing the provincial death toll to 9,214.A total of 534,558 coronavirus cases are considered resolved, which is up by 286.
